What you need to know before you hire anyone are FDA handicap laws. You can't add a roll in shower for a wheel chair unless there is ample room to turn a chair acound.- this is close to a 10x10 room. All kinds of special stuff to needed in this scenario. My sisterinlaw who does have the shower said it cost about $10k extra to add the shower to the new house and it took a plumber to do it correctly. The non-slip tile and all the other stuff was extra. There are also bath wheelchairs with the removable potty for the incontent patient to consider too.

Do be careful that you get what you need. Your state may have a list of qualified installers and builders. Do check. You can also check with the local plumbers union, or even your local plumber first before you hire. Get bids. It is easy or as small as it seems.
